package_parser/pkgs/
swift.rs

1use std::{fs::File, path::Path};
2
3use crate::types::{DependentPackage, Package};
4use serde_json::Value;
5
6use crate::{error::SourcePkgError, PackageManifest};
7
8mod v1 {
9    use serde::Deserialize;
10
11    #[derive(Debug, Deserialize)]
12    pub struct LockFile {
13        pub object: Object,
14    }
15
16    #[derive(Debug, Deserialize)]
17    pub struct Object {
18        #[serde(default)]
19        pub pins: Vec<PinnedPackage>,
20    }
21
22    #[derive(Debug, Deserialize)]
23    pub struct PinnedPackage {
24        pub package: String,
25        #[serde(rename = "repositoryURL")]
26        pub repository_url: Option<String>,
27        pub state: PinnedPackageState,
28    }
29
30    #[derive(Debug, Deserialize)]
31    #[serde(rename_all = "camelCase")]
32    pub struct PinnedPackageState {
33        pub version: Option<String>,
34        // pub branch: Option<String>,
35        pub revision: Option<String>,
36    }
37}
38
39mod v2 {
40    use serde::Deserialize;
41
42    #[derive(Debug, Deserialize)]
43    pub struct LockFile {
44        pub pins: Vec<PinnedPackage>,
45    }
46
47    #[derive(Debug, Deserialize)]
48    #[allow(unused)]
49    pub struct PinnedPackage {
50        pub location: String,
51        pub state: PinnedPackageState,
52    }
53
54    #[derive(Debug, Deserialize)]
55    #[allow(unused)]
56    pub struct PinnedPackageState {
57        pub version: Option<String>,
58        pub revision: Option<String>,
59    }
60}
61
62fn repo_url_to_purl(url: &str) -> Option<String> {
63    let url = if let Some(url) = url.split_once("://") {
64        url.1
65    } else {
66        return None;
67    };
68
69    let url = url.strip_suffix(".git").unwrap_or(url);
70
71    Some(format!("pkg:swift/{}", url))
72}
73
74pub struct SwiftPmLock;
75
76impl SwiftPmLock {
77    pub fn new() -> Self {
78        Self
79    }
80
81    fn parse(path: &Path) -> Result<Package, SourcePkgError> {
82        let file = File::open(path)?;
83        let resolved: Value = serde_json::from_reader(file)?;
84
85        let mut deps = vec![];
86
87        let version = resolved.get("version").and_then(|v| v.as_i64());
88        match version {
89            Some(1) => {
90                let resolved = serde_json::from_value::<v1::LockFile>(resolved)?;
91                for pkg in resolved.object.pins {
92                    let url = if let Some(url) = pkg.repository_url {
93                        url
94                    } else {
95                        log::warn!("No URL for package {}", pkg.package);
96                        continue;
97                    };
98
99                    let mut purl = if let Some(purl) = repo_url_to_purl(&url) {
100                        purl
101                    } else {
102                        log::warn!("Could not convert URL {} to purl", url);
103                        continue;
104                    };
105
106                    let version = pkg.state.version.or(pkg.state.revision);
107
108                    if let Some(v) = &version {
109                        purl.push_str(&format!("@{}", v));
110                    }
111
112                    let dep = DependentPackage {
113                        purl,
114                        requirement: version.unwrap_or_default(),
115                        scope: "".into(),
116                        is_runtime: true,
117                        is_optional: false,
118                        is_resolved: true,
119                        ..Default::default()
120                    };
121
122                    deps.push(dep);
123                }
124            }
125            Some(2) => {
126                let resolved = serde_json::from_value::<v2::LockFile>(resolved)?;
127
128                for pkg in resolved.pins {
129                    let url = pkg.location;
130
131                    let mut purl = if let Some(purl) = repo_url_to_purl(&url) {
132                        purl
133                    } else {
134                        log::warn!("Could not convert URL {} to purl", url);
135                        continue;
136                    };
137
138                    let version = pkg.state.version.or(pkg.state.revision);
139
140                    if let Some(v) = &version {
141                        purl.push_str(&format!("@{}", v));
142                    }
143
144                    let dep = DependentPackage {
145                        purl,
146                        requirement: version.unwrap_or_default(),
147                        scope: "".into(),
148                        is_runtime: true,
149                        is_optional: false,
150                        is_resolved: true,
151                        ..Default::default()
152                    };
153
154                    deps.push(dep);
155                }
156            }
157            v => {
158                return Err(SourcePkgError::GenericsError2(format!(
159                    "Unrecognized swift package manager lock file version: {:?}",
160                    v
161                )));
162            }
163        }
164
165        Ok(Package {
166            dependencies: deps,
167            ..Default::default()
168        })
169    }
170}
171
172#[async_trait::async_trait]
173impl PackageManifest for SwiftPmLock {
174    fn get_name(&self) -> String {
175        "swift".to_string()
176    }
177
178    async fn recognize(&self, path: &Path) -> Result<Package, SourcePkgError> {
179        Self::parse(path)
180    }
181
182    fn file_name_patterns(&self) -> &'static [&'static str] {
183        &["Package.resolved"]
184    }
